Doctors Believe 9-year-old Girl will not Survive after Flu B Diagnosis


Mia Klyczek, a 9-year-old from Alden, is currently in critical condition at Oishei Children's Hospital after being diagnosed with influenza B.


Mia was taken to the emergency room in the early hours of February 19th experiencing symptoms that included a mild fever and vomiting. According to a GoFundMe page created to support her family, she suffered a seizure and required sedation along with a breathing tube for assistance.



Her family reports that medical professionals believe the flu B virus has led to significant swelling and bleeding in her brain as well as complications related to her heart. They are reaching out to the community for prayers and support, hoping for a miracle in Mia's recovery.



On Thursday morning, Mia's mother Christina shared an update on Facebook, stating, "The neurologists informed us that the swelling in her brain is severe. Unfortunately, there is no surgical option to alleviate the pressure beyond the current treatments. They do not believe she will survive."
